- the present invention relates a portable refreshing device.
- the present invention relates to a device suitable to develop, through a manual operation, a flow of humid fluid micro-particles to be sprayed on the skin or parts of users' body.
- Said fluid is constituted entirely or partly by water taken from any point of water networks, or made available by conventional containers such as bottles or the like.
- refreshing paper napkins are used or, if the condition so allows, conventional atomizers of the type generally used to spray detergents along the surfaces to be cleaned.
- this solution is sometime counter-productive, as said napkins are impregnated with substances whose refreshing effect is a minimum one, maybe immediate but that dissipates very soon; in the second case, the conventional atomizers may actually bring relief, but have the non-negligible drawback of spraying high amounts of liquid, which can give rise to the formation of many drops and trickles on the body part concerned by the treatment.
- Such a situation can be tolerated only in some conditions, when the subject is in a state of substantial privacy; in other cases, apart from the necessity of drying, at least partially, after the spraying the wet body parts, with regard, at least to the eyes, such atomization can create an overall uncomfortable sensation, being excessive with respect to the requirement of liquid supply.
- Object of the present invention is to obviate the above drawbacks.
- object of the present invention is to realize a portable refreshing device allowing, at any time and on any condition, to be so activated as to wet body parts with minimum and calibrated amounts of liquid, causing an effective refrigerating action.
- a further object of the invention is to realize a refreshing device whose activation creates a micro-mist, as the liquid is mixed with air in correspondence of the outlet nozzle.
- a not least object of the invention is to realize a refreshing device that, being portable, does not require the setting up of specific supports and can be activated by users in a quick and easy manner in any place.
- Another object of the invention is to realize a refreshing device allowing to utilize as a reservoir also flexible and pliable containers, that are therefore easily transportable in a hand-bag, a prior pressurization of the liquid being not required.
- a further object of the invention is to provide users with a refreshing device able to ensure a high level of resistance and reliability in the time, and also such as to be easily and economically realizable.
- the portable refreshing device of the present invention which may have any shape and size and be obtained from plastic material or other suitable materials, basically characterized in that it comprises a reservoir with slightly pressurized air connected through a tube to a handle or a grip integrating a cavity containing a liquid coming from the front part of said grip through a nozzle, and at least a pipe for the supply of the air contained in said reservoir which air comes out close to the liquid brought by the nozzle, said reservoir incorporating a hand-activated pump, located in a cavity of said reservoir, with a hole provided with a unidirectional valve.
- the portable refreshing device of the present invention indicated as a whole by 10 in Figure 1, comprises a containing unit or reservoir 12, of any shape and size, a small pump 14, for instance of the bellows-type, integrated in said reservoir, and a handle or grip 16 connected through a tube 18 to said reservoir and incorporating a plurality a ducts that flow at the front end in as many supplying nozzles, which will be described later on.
- a cavity 20 is formed that communicates with the outside through a hole closed by a plug 22.
- Reservoir 12 made, for instance, from rigid plastic or plasticized fabric, is intended for containing ambient air which is slightly compressed by a manual action exercised on pump 14 of a substantially known type.
- reservoir 12 has a first recess or shaped seat 24 having a shape entirely complementary to that of the pump 14 that abuts in the same and is stabilized with known means, for instance, adhesives, the upper front of pump 14 is defined by the conventional elastic membrane, indicated by 14', which is hand-compressed in order to pressurize the air in reservoir 12; by way of orientation, the pressures realized in said reservoir is comprised between 0.2 and 1.5 bar.
- an unidirectional valve 26 is located that prevents air from downflowing from reservoir 12.
- a second recess or shaped seat 30 is formed, whose mouth is oriented towards the upper part of said reservoir; said second shaped seat 30, having by way of example a circular plan, constitutes the housing seat of tube 18, advantageously of the coiled type, that causes reservoir 12 to get in touch with handle or grip 16.
- a nonreturn valve 32 is preferably located in correspondence of the end of tube 18, directed to reservoir 12; tube 18 is respectively fastened to the base of the second recess 30 and grip 16 by means of conventional quick attachments or like means.
- Said grip advantageously made from plastic material, has in the preferred embodiment a "spout" conformation, made up by two complementary and specular half-shells connected with one another by heat welding, ultrasound welding or like systems.
- the base of grip 16 i.e. the part that connects with tube 18, has an integral tang 34 for the clutch of said tube; in axial alignment with tang 34, a cylindrical seat 44 is formed that develops in the grip and houses an unidirectional valve 46 elastically tensioned by a helical spring 48.
- Said valve 46 is so shaped as to be localizable along a seat 46', preferably conical, that forms a choke 50 in seat 44.
- the upper part of the latter opposed to tang 34 is provided with at least a through-opening 50', radially developed, that causes said seat to get in communication with cavity 20 of grip 16.
- Opening(s) 50' is obtained over seat 46' of valve 46.
- Choke 50 in its lower part facing tube 18, is preferably conified in the same way as seat 46' and forms a mouth interceptable by the shaped end 52 of an operating lever 36, hand-actionable and having its fulcrum on the body of grip 16.
- Lever 36 comes out from the latter through an opening 52', circumscribed by a gasket 53 of the O-ring type or the like.
- Cavity 20 of grip 16 is suitable to receive the liquid, typically water, let in starting from the mouth shielded by plug 22; by way of indication, said cavity is so sized as to contain an amount of liquid comprised between 0.10 and 0.30 liters.
- a duct 42 comes out, integral with grip 16, which branches into at least two tubes 42', developed in a mutually opposed direction throughout the extension of grip 16, in the inside thereof. Tubes 42', opposed to each other, end at the front end of said grip and in such position they bear a conventional supply nozzle whose flow is adjustable and preferably orientable.
- a holed diaphragm 40 possibly shielded by a unidirectional valve 40', which intercepts or open the passage of the liquid present in cavity 20.
- grip 16 Downstream of said diaphragm 40, grip 16 has an additional supply nozzle, indicated by 70, which is advantageously located in an intermediate position with respect to the other two nozzles located at the front end of tubes 42' at the outlet from grip 16.
- the mouth of the second shaped seat 30 is provided with a projection or serration 60, to hook to reservoir 12 the rear part of grip 16, which in the opposite front part is housed along a flat zone 62 created on the same reservoir, extended in an extension 64 which constitutes the fitting-insertion seat of said front part of said grip.
- the latter housed in said seats, advantageously constitutes also the gripping means to transport the device as a whole, reservoir included, when it is not utilized.
- tube 18 can come out extending into the second cavity 30 and therefore said grip 16 can be oriented in the space to be led close to the body part to be refreshed.
- cavity 20 is filled entirely or partly with water, previously let in through the hole closed by plug 22, the only operation to be made by the user is the activation with some impulses of membrane 14' of pump 14, to create in the inside of reservoir 12, which contains only water, a pressure slightly higher than the ambient or environment one.
- the device object of the invention can operate by acting on lever 36. This handling causes the downwards shifting of the shaped end 52 of lever 36, and the pressurized air present in reservoir 12 can therefore flow into seat 44, into choke 50, and from here into the fluid-containing cavity 20.
- the ensuing refreshing effect is, from the one hand, effective, but does not cause, on the other hand, the distribution of excessive amounts of liquid on the skin.
- the device can work continuously provided there is an even minimum amount of liquid in cavity 20, as the user has the possibility of activating repeatedly or at intervals with one hand membrane 14' of pump 14 and with the other hand lever 36, connected to grip 16.
- the device of the present invention allows to obtain an immediate refreshing effect along body zones, and, given its structural configuration, it can be easily utilized in many situations, not necessarily referred to those of typical relax in open and sunny, or in any case hot, spaces.
- Such a device in fact, may be easily transported and used, if needed, in other environments, for instance in cars or campers during travels, without the need of unavoidable stops.
- the only requirement is the availability of a minimum amount of liquid, typically water, in cavity 20 of grip 16.
- Reservoir 12 may be obtained from a flexible material, which further reduces the overall size, moreover already limited, while the global weight of said device, that does not require high amounts of liquid to be let in the reservoir, is negligible.
- the supply ducts of exiting air which invests the drop or drops of liquid to create the micro-mist, may be present in a higher number or have a location different from what has been described and illustrate by way of example; alternatively, thanks to the central duct from which the drop or drops of liquid exit, one only external annular duct for air inlet may be provided, with a suitable configuration of the outlet mouth to orient and concentrate the air flow in the direction of the nozzle from which the liquid comes out.
